@import url("borders.css");
@import url("widgets.css");

/*全局css设定*/
BODY {margin:0;color:#666;font:9pt Tahoma,"宋体",Arial,Helvetica,Sans-Serif;letter-spacing:0;line-height:150%;}
h2 {font-family:Arial, Helvetica, sans-serif;}
h3, h4 {font:bold 12px "Arial,Helvetica,sans-serif";color:#333;}
A {color:#666;text-decoration:none;}
A:hover { color:#CA0809;text-decoration:underline;}
em,cite {font-style:normal;}
ol {padding:10px}
ol li {color:#555;border-style:dotted;}
.hidden {display:none;}
.mtp5 {margin-top:5px;}
.mtp8 {margin-top:8px;}
.mtp10 {margin-top:10px;}
.mtp12 {margin-top:12px;}
.mtp15 {margin-top:15px;}
.mg15 {margin-top:15px;margin-bottom:15px;}
.mtp20 {margin-top:20px;}
.mtp30 {margin-top:30px;}
.more {margin:0;}
.fL {float:left;}
.fR {float:right;}
.red a,.red {color:#FF0000;}
.center {text-align:center;}
.more {text-align:right;margin:0;}
.clear {clear:both;font-size:0;line-height:0;height:0;border:0;}

a.blue { color:#3366cc;}
a.blue:link { color:#3366cc;}
a.blue:visited{ color:#3366cc;}
a.blue:hover { color:#3366cc;}

a.red,.more a { color:#CC0000;}
a.red:hover,.more a:hover { color:#CC0000;}

/*=========================页面排版与分栏========================*/
.AllWrap {width:960px;margin-left:auto;margin-right:auto;}

/*页面通用头部css*/
#head {height:76px;}
.logo {float:left;width:217px;padding-top:5px;}	
.head_right {
	display: block;
    float:right;
    height:auto;
    padding-top:5px;
    text-align:right;
}
.head_user {height:17px;}
.head_user ul {float:right;}
.head_user li {
	color: #D8D8D8;
    text-align:left;
	float:left;
	padding:0 2px;
	line-height:17px;
	height:17px;
	line-height:17px;
}
.head_user span {color:#666;}
.head_user a {display:inline-block;margin:0 2px;*margin:0 4px;}
.head_user .login a {color:#C90809;}

/*头部我的账户弹出样式*/
.Account {}
.Account a.myAccount {background:url("public_bg.gif") no-repeat right 3px;line-height:17px;padding-right:15px;position:relative;z-index:9999;}
.head_user .current {position:relative;z-index:998;}
.head_user .current a.myAccount {background-position:-392px 3px;}
.head_user .Account_pop {display:none;}
.head_user .current .Account_pop {display:block;position:absolute;height:auto;padding-top:20px;width:75px;*width:77px !important;*width:75px;left:-7px;top:-3px;background-color:#fff;border:1px solid #c2c2c2;overflow:hidden;padding-bottom:3px;text-align:left;z-index:9998;}

.head_user .Account_pop a {margin-left:8px;display:block;}
						
.head_other {padding-top:10px;height:37px;z-index:1;text-align:right;}


/*new图标*/
.hot_span {position:absolute;display:block;right:183px;top:8px;height:11px;width:21px;line-height:0;font-size:0;background:url("public_bg.gif") no-repeat -532px -98px;}

/*页面通用横向导航栏css*/
#channel_box  {height:32px;background-color:#CA0809;border-top:1px solid #E31C1F;clear:both;}


/*页面通用横向导航栏下方搜索板块css*/	
.sobox {height:36px;margin-bottom:12px;border-bottom:2px solid #f2f2f2;background:#F6F6F6;}	
.sobox .so {height:28px;padding-top:7px;border:1px solid #e4e4e4;border-top:0;overflow:hidden;white-space:nowrap;}
.sobox .so .keywords {padding:0;height:20px;line-height:20px;width:150px;border:1px solid #d2d2d2;background:url("public_bg.gif") no-repeat -537px -23px;background-color:#fff;color:#9b9b9b;
padding-left:20px;margin-right:5px;margin-left:11px;}
.sobox .so .btn_search {
		height:22px;
		width:48px;
		border:none;
		cursor:pointer;
		background:url("public_bg.gif") no-repeat 0px -27px;
		text-indent:-9999px;
}
.sobox .hotkey {
		margin-left:12px;
}
.sobox .hotkey li {
	float:left;
	margin-right:14px;
	line-height:20px;
	*line-height:22px;
}
.sobox .hotkey li.front strong {color:#FF6600;}
.sobox .hotkey a{color:#666;}
.sobox .hotkey a:hover {color:#CA0809;}


/*修改，头部导航。*/
#Menu ul.qfnavs {height:32px;line-height:32px;padding-left:8px;float:left;}
#Menu ul.qfnavs li {float:left;margin-right:4px;}
#Menu ul.qfnavs li a {color:#FFF;font-weight:bold;display:block;padding-left:7px;}
#Menu ul.qfnavs li a span {display:block; padding-right: 7px;}
#Menu ul.qfnavs li a:hover,#channel_box ul.qfnavs li a.current {color:#CA0809;background:url("quwan_red.gif") no-repeat left 1px;text-decoration:none;}
#Menu ul.qfnavs li a:hover span,#channel_box ul.qfnavs li a.current span {background:url("quwan_red.gif") no-repeat right 1px;}
#Menu ul.qfnavs li.AllCats a:hover,
#Menu ul.qfnavs li.hover a {background:url("quwan_red.gif") no-repeat left -32px;}
#Menu ul.qfnavs li.hover a {color:#CA0809;}
#Menu ul.qfnavs li.AllCats a:hover span,
#Menu ul.qfnavs li.hover a span {background:url("quwan_red.gif") no-repeat right -32px;}

#flybox {width:652px;margin:0 auto;position:absolute;z-index:999;visibility:hidden;background-color:#FFF;opacity:0;}
.nav_pop {width:620px;padding:10px 12px 10px 18px;border:1px solid #5f5f5f;border-top:none;}
.nav_pop .GoodsCategoryWrap {border:none;}
.nav_pop .c-cat-depth-1 {width:200px;padding:0;display:inline;background:none;float:left;margin:5px 6px 0 0;}
.nav_pop .c-cat-depth-1 a {font-weight:600;color:#CA0809;line-height:24px;background:none;display:block;border-bottom:1px solid #b3b3b3;padding-bottom:3px;}
.nav_pop .c-cat-depth-1 .c-cat-depth-2 a {font-weight:normal;color:#333;line-height:22px;display:inline;border:none;margin:0;}
.nav_pop .c-cat-depth-1 td a {font-weight:normal;line-height:20px;padding:0 0 0 5px;color:#444;}
.nav_pop .c-cat-depth-1 a:hover {color:#CA0809;}


/*=============================页面通用页脚css========================*/		
#foot {
	margin: 0px auto;
	width: 100%;
	height:auto;
	color:#000000;
	background:url("public_bg.gif") repeat-x 0 -310px;
	background-color:#fafafa;
	margin-top:15px;
}		
#footer {
	padding-top:25px;
	height:auto;
}
#phone {
	float:left;
	width:166px;
	height:113px;
	position:relative;
	overflow:hidden;
}
#phone img {
	position:absolute;
	top:-197px;
	left:-319px;
}

/*底部帮助中心*/
.help_box  {
	float:right; 
	width:794px;
	height:130px;
}		
.help {
	float:left;
	width:137px;
	padding-left:21px;
	height:117px;
}
		
.guarantee{
	height:68px;
	width:960px;
	position:relative;
}
 	.guarantee dt { position:absolute; z-index:0;top:2px;*top:0px !important;*top:0px; left:2px;height:68px; width:960px; background-color:#f0f0f0;}
	.guarantee dd { border:1px solid #d1d1d1;width:953px; background-color:#fff; text-align:center; height:auto; padding:16px 0 16px 5px;position:absolute;z-index:1; top:0; left:0;}
	.guarantee dd a { display:inline-block; height:31px;background-image:url("public_bg.gif"); background-repeat:no-repeat;}
	.guar_1 { width:300px;background-position:0 -67px;}
	.guar_2 {width:315px;background-position:0 -98px;}
	.guar_3 {width:290px;background-position:0 -129px;}

	
/*网站荣誉*/
.honor {margin-top:12px;}
.honor ul li.bgimg {
	background-image:url("public_bg.gif"); 
	background-repeat:no-repeat;
	float:left;
	margin-right:10px;
	height:50px;
}
.honor ul li.bgimg a {
	display:block;
	height:50px;
	text-indent:-9999px;
	width:100%;
	overflow:hidden;
}
.honor ul li.last {margin-right:0;}
.honor ul li.honor1 { width:155px;background-position:0px -160px;}
.honor ul li.honor2 {width:162px;background-position:-155px -160px;}
.honor ul li.honor3 {width:155px;background-position:0px -210px;}
.honor ul li.honor4 {width:119px;background-position:-155px -210px;}
.honor ul li.honor5 {width:164px;background-position:0px -260px;}
.honor ul li.honor6 {width:155px;background-position:-164px -260px;}

/*底部链接*/
.flinks {color:#777;text-align:center;height:16px;margin:20px 0 0;}
.flinks .TreeList div {display:inline;padding-right:12px;margin-right:10px;border-right:1px solid #EAEAEA;}
.flinks .TreeList .last {border-right:0;}
.flinks .TreeList div a{color:#999;font-weight:normal;} 
.flinks .TreeList div a:hover {color:#C90809;} 

/*底部版权*/
#copyright  {text-align:center;color:#999;margin-top:10px;margin-top0:0\9;*margin-top:0px;padding-bottom:30px;line-height:22px;}
#copyright P{margin-bottom:0;}
	
/*返回顶部按钮*/
.gotop {background:url("scroll.png") no-repeat;width:21px;height:65px; cursor:pointer;}	
	

/*Shopex常用产品相关色彩修改*/
.GoodsList .item h6,.GoodsShow .gname {white-space:normal;height:32px;line-height:16px;overflow:hidden;width:130px;text-align:left;font-weight:normal;color:#666;margin:5px auto 0;overflow:hidden;}/*产品名称*/
.GoodsList .item h6 a,.GoodsShow .gname a,.GoodsSearchWrap .items-gallery .goodinfo h6 a{color:#666;font-weight:normal;font-size:12px;}
.GoodsList .item h6 a:hover,.GoodsShow .gname a:hover,.GoodsSearchWrap .items-gallery .goodinfo h6 a:hover {text-decoration:underline;color:#C90809;}
.price,.price0,.price1,.GoodsList .item .price1,.GoodsList .price,.GoodsList .price0,.GoodsSearchWrap .items-gallery .goodinfo .price1 {color:#D33302;font-size: 12px;font-weight:bold;font-family: Arial,Helvetica,sans-serif;} /*现价*/
.mkprice,.mkprice0,.mktprice1,del,.GoodsList .mktprice1,.GoodsList .mktprice0 {color:#999;text-decoration:line-through;font-size:12px;font-weight:400;font-family: Arial, Helvetica, sans-serif;} /*原价*/
.items-list .mktprice1 {margin-left:10px;}
.GoodsList .item ul li {text-align:left;line-height:22px;width:130px;margin:0 auto;}

.GoodsSearchWrap .items-gallery h6 span.goodsbrand a{color:#A0A0A0;} /*商品品牌*/
.GoodsSearchWrap .items-gallery h6 span.goodsbrand a:hover{color:#648A25;}
.GoodsSearchWrap .items-gallery span.goodsScore {color:#648A25}  /*商品积分*/
.GoodsSearchWrap .items-gallery span.ccount {background: url("newchannel_bg.gif") no-repeat -181px -22px;padding-left: 20px;} /*商品评论数*/


/*常用按钮样式*/
.btn-login,.btn-register,.btn-fastbuy,.btn-buy,.btn-notify,.btn-return-checkout,.btn-return,.btn-next {background:url("button.gif") no-repeat;}
.btn-login {background-position:0px 0px;width:98px;height:30px;}
.btn-register {background-position:0px -31px;width:98px;height:30px;}
.btn-notify {background-position:0px -169px;width:153px;height:41px;} /*到货通知*/
.btn-fastbuy {background-position:0px -253px;width:153px;height:41px;} /*立即购买*/
.btn-buy {background-position:0px -211px;width:153px;height:41px;} /*加入购物车*/
.btn-return-checkout {background-position:-123px -33px;width:103px;height:24px;} /*返回购物车*/
.btn-return  {background-position:0px -102px;width:111px;height:33px;}/*继续购物*/
.btn-next {background-position:0px -135px;width:97px;height:33px;}/*去结算*/
